Graphic novels have enjoyed a meteoric rise in popularity in the last five years. Since 2019, sales of graphic novels have risen over 100 percent. While that growth has leveled off, graphic novels are now the third best-selling genre (35 million books sold) in the U.S. and Canada, behind only general fiction (49 million) and romance (36 million). What’s fueled this spike in popularity?

Christian fiction has flourished over the years, with subgenres like historical fiction, Regency romance, and contemporary women’s fiction. To expand their readership, Christian publishers are now embracing thrillers. These character-driven adventures offer high-intensity plots with moral challenges and inspirational moments. Move over, manga! With the burgeoning popularity of webtoons, K-drama, and K-pop, manhwa—comics from Korea—have made a big impact on English-language audiences. Chinese comics, manhua, are growing in number as well. Unlike manga, most manhua and manhwa available in English are in color and read from left to right. Almost all were originally published online in the vertical-scroll webtoon format and have shorter chapters than manga.

Decodables, or simple books written for beginning readers, have become staples in elementary school classrooms and libraries everywhere, and for good reason. By encouraging children to sound out words using decoding strategies rather than guessing from pictures or predicting from other cues, decodables help emergent readers learn to read independently.
